I applied through a recruiter.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at GCI Health in Mar 2020
Interview
Recruiter reached out to me on LinkedIn and set up a call about the open role. From there it was a few interviews with members of different teams, all conducted virtually because of covid-19. The entire process took TWO WEEKS. I had a really positive experience and was interviewing with other agencies but ultimately chose GCIH because of how organized and seamless the process was. The writing test was a bit challenging under two hours but I think they take a pretty holistic view of the candidate and assess whether they're a good fit beyond that.
